BBQ Roast Waffle Sandwich
Directions:
- Season your chuck roast with Slap Ya Mama, Garlic Powder, Smoked Paprika.
- Add olive oil to the Instant Pot. Set the setting on Saute'.
- Once the oil is heated. Brown the Roast on both sides.
- Slice Onions Julienne.
- Saute the onions in the Instant Pot. Once the onions are sautéed.
- Change the setting on the Instant Pot to Stew and set for high heat for 1 hour 30 minutes.
- Add Beef broth. Stir occasionally to prevent sticking.
- While the roast is cooking, Fry the bacon slices. Drain on a paper towel and set aside.
- Mix the Pancake mix. Follow the instructions. (Waffle mix works fine as well). Add in shredded cheese, a generous amount.
- When there is about 15 minutes left start making your waffles.
- Once the waffles are cooked. Add additional shredded cheese if desired.
- Mix the Chopped Salad Mix as instructed. We had the Garden Lime Crunch. Use lettuce or cabbage if desired.
- At 5 minutes left on the Instant Pot. Remove the roast and slice on an angle into 1 inch pieces.
- Add most of the bbq sauce to the pot and stir.
- Add the meat to the pot. Stir.
- Cover until you are ready to build the waffle sandwich.
- Heat the remainder of the BBQ sauce and set aside.
- Crumble the bacon.
- Heat the pork n beans in a pot. Add the butter and bacon to the pork n beans.
- Build the waffle sandwich. Waffle topped with pork n beans (Spread), sliced bbq roast, chopped salad mix, drizzle a little more bbq sauce, add top waffle, top with a pickle stick skewer through the sandwich. Enjoy.
